Kwara Plans 6,000 Housing Units - Hon. Muhammed Babakpan Isah

Date: 2012-10-04

The kwara state commissioner for Housing and Urban Development, Hon. Muhammed Babakpan Isah, has said that the present administration in the state is to construct 6,000 housing units within its tenure.

Isah disclosed this on Monday during an interview with newsmen during the just concluded 52nd Independence anniversary of Nigeria held at Metropolitan Square, along Asa-Dam road, Ilorin, the state capital.

The commissioner explained that effort is on top gear to achieve its set objective of building 6,000 houses between now and the next three years.

According to him, "We have a robust plan for housing and urban development in kwara. We are doing this to make housing available and affordable for the teeming kwarans for them to realise their dreams of becoming house owners.

"We want to achieve this by providing at least about 6,000 housing units in kwara within our tenure in office" the commissioner pledged.

He added that the government plans to achieve the 6,000 housing units by partnering with Public developers under the Public Private Partnership (PPP) arrangement.

"We plan to achieve this housing projects by partnering with Public developers under the PPP arrangement. The government will commit the land for the project and the development will be undertaken by the private investors.

Isah called on kwarans to be patient with the present administration in the state, promising that governor Abdulfatah Ahmed led administration in the state would not relent in its efforts to evolve propgrammes and policies that will have direct bearing on the lives of kwarans.

Also speaking with newsmen, the General Manager of the state Housing Corporation, Architect Saliu Sulaiman, who described housing as a continuous exercise, said the provision of housing was placed on utmost priority by the state government.

"Housing is a continuous thing, there is no starting point and there is no end point to housing. The plan is always in place and the delivery is a continuous process.

"Very soon we are going to see much that is going to be delivered for kwaransin terms of housing. Definitely, it is going to be better than what it has always been" Sulaiman promised.
